Roger & The Gypsies was a one-off New Orleans-based collaboration between Earl Stanley & The Stereos and Eddie Bo (Edwin Joseph Bocage (1930 – 2009). They recorded one single in 1966, Pass The Hatchet, which was the very first record released on Joe Banashak's Seven B label. The group was named after lead guitarist Earl Stanley's cousin Roger Leon, who had thought up the riff and title of the track. More…
